What Is Real Estate Law?

Real estate law is the legal practice area involving the buying, selling, and owning of commercial or residential property. Real estate represents the largest investment most people make, and any legal issues can put your investment at risk. Types of real estate law cases involve:

  • Buying a home
  • Selling real estate
  • Title claims and disputes
  • Property insurance claims
  • Environmental claims
  • Construction disputes
  • Homeowner association (HOA) disputes

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Real Estate Lawyer?

For simple property transactions, you may not need a real estate lawyer, depending on what New Jersey law requires. However, when your property involves any complications or financial claims, a real estate lawyer can review your case and identify your legal options. In some cases, that might mean filing a lawsuit to protect your property. Examples of situations where you might want to talk to a real estate lawyer include:

  • Purchasing a piece of residential or commercial property as-is
  • Purchasing a property with a non-traditional purchase contract
  • Buying or selling a property without an agent or broker
  • Resolving a zoning dispute with a neighbor or the Bound Brook government
  • Purchasing property with a quit claim deed
  • Buying formerly industrial property

How Can a Real Estate Lawyer Help Me?

A real estate lawyer can help you through the real estate process. With so much money on the line, it is wise to work with a lawyer to protect your investment. A real estate lawyer can help with:

  • Breach of contract claims
  • Property insurance claim denials
  • Title disputes
  • Zoning restrictions
  • HOA restrictions
  • Negotiating commercial lease agreements
  • Handling property tax matters

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Real Estate Lawyer?

If you don’t hire a real estate lawyer, you could be putting your home or business at risk. Problems with a real estate deal can quickly spiral out of control, costing you tens of thousands of dollars or more. Property ownership or title disputes can cost you your home. Without a real estate lawyer, you could face:

  • Property and zoning restrictions
  • Property tax penalties
  • Breach of contract claims
  • Environmental remediation costs

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Real Estate Lawyer in Bound Brook?

These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case. Many real estate lawyers offer an initial consultation that allows you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ions to ask include:

  • What is your experience in handling real estate cases in New Jersey?
  • Have you represented property owners in cases like mine?
  • What are potential issues that can come up during the property purchase?
  • How will you keep me informed about updates in my case?
  • What is the likely timeline for resolving my case?
  • What is your fee structure for legal representation?

Tips for Hiring a Real Estate Lawyer

Take the time to find a real estate attorney who is right for you and will represent your best interests. Find a lawyer who understands your case, knows your needs and goals, and has the experience to get the best outcome. Things to do:

  • Ask for recommendations
  • Research lawyers online
  • Schedule consultations
  • Review experience and expertise
  • Talk about fees and billing
  • Trust your instincts
